Initially they were merging with Shetland, but Shetland withdrew midweek, leaving Orkney short of players. They came anyway and games were played at U13/14, U15/16 and U18, with Ellon lending players over at all three age bands to ensure proper games went ahead. Some good games with everyone getting game time. Ellon won all three, but it was more about a decent training game rather than a conference game.
Ellon U16 lent over 5 players to Orkney and they played the whole game for Orkney as they were enjoying it. Ellon's Felix Middleton scored two of Orkneys three tries. Man of the Match Ryan Dickie scored a hattrick for Ellon.
Next weekend is similar with Ellon hosting Ross Sutherland Youth at the Meadows Sunday 12:00 ko. Games will be at U13/14, U15/16 only this weekend. This is a cross conference fixture.
After that Ellon Youth face Deeside at home, then Gordonstoun away in the last games of the conference. Only maximum points will see Ellon taking the Overall club conference title for the first time. U16 need a win against Deeside to take second spot. First or Second spot for U16 means qualifying for National Cup.
